Eating for your body type

By Nelly Obadha

Whenever body types and the relevant exercises are discussed, it is often in reference to women. Rarely are men’s body types and the specific fitness regime suitable for each type discussed.

Just like women, men have specific body types or a combination of two or more types.

Body types in men are usually determined by how easy it is to gain or lose weight and build muscles. Men fall in three categories of body types, which determine the kind of fitness regime to adopt.

Ectomorphs

This body type is described as skinny, light build with lean muscles and small joints. Gaining weight for most ectomorphs is usually an uphill task and many give up trying and resign to their fate.

Ectomorphs have a high metabolic rate.  The food and energy in their bodies get used up faster that it can be stored. Such people need a lot of calories to gain weight.

To ensure they are fit, ectomorphs need to eat more and engage in exercises that build the muscles.

Mesomorphs

Mesomorphs are known for their large bone structure and are naturally athletic. They find it easy to gain and lose weight. They have a hard body and well-defined muscle structures that are easy to build.

Because they gain weight easily, mesomorphs face the danger of gaining unhealthy weight. Anyone with this type of body must watch what they eat; otherwise, they may gain too much weight.

The best exercises for mesomorphs should be a combination of aerobics and moderate weight lifting. Due to the fact that this body type gains muscles faster, you must be careful how much you train.

Endomorphs

Endomorphs usually have a short build with thick arms and legs. It is much easy to describe them as soft and round. They easily gain muscle and fats. The downside of being an endomorph is that you many find it hard to lose fat because of a slow metabolic rate.

To be fit, people with this body type should do cardio exercises and weight training. Cardio exercises burn excess calories while weight lifting builds muscles. Endomorphs should also watch what they eat to ensure they don’t gain excess weight.
